What is a CCTV camera?
CCTV stands for “closed-circuit television”. CCTV cameras produce surveillance videos or images that are sent to a desktop computer, a laptop or a video tape recorder. A CCTV camera can either be analog or digital.
Some CCTV cameras can also record audio. They may also be connected to a network with an IP address. The image quality can vary, depending on the type and brand of camera. Some have as low as 640 x 680 pixels, while others have 1280 x 960 megapixels.
Why get an internal CCTV camera?
CCTV cameras are generally used in business establishments and offices. However, the use of security cameras in homes is starting to become more and more popular.
Most employees feel more secure with the knowledge that their office is equipped with surveillance cameras. Anyone who may have intentions of doing any criminal or illegal activity will think twice when their actions are being monitored and recorded. Employers will also find it easier to track down suspicious activities with the use of footage’s from a security camera.
In the event of anything untoward or unlawful happening in the company premises, video footage or pictures from the camera will help police in their investigation. Especially when the footage is in higher resolution, CCTV cameras can also show the perpetrator’s face or any identifying characteristics that they have.
If you are a home owner and a parent, installing surveillance cameras in your home can help you have a better look at what happens when you’re not around. This is especially useful if you leave your kids with a nanny or if you hired a house help.
Installing an internal CCTV camera
Although you may find self help guides on how to install a security camera yourself, it is always best to get someone certified to do the job. Installing the internal CCTV camera requires ensuring the right cables are used, with the right source of power supply, positioning the camera in the right location and angle, and connecting the camera to a monitor. Plugging the camera in the wrong power supply can cause major damage not just to the camera, but to your home too.
